Yes, the hotshoe problem is quite well known. But it only happened to the early batches of D700. When fitted with SB-900, the thicker feet of the SB-900 can give problems to the D700 hotshoe. But all later models of the D700 are all fitted with newer hotshoes.

I've experienced this problem before after more than 3 years of using my D700. I sent my D700 to Nikon in El Segundo at the time and they replaced the hotshoe, replaced the rubber grip, cleaned the sensor and checked the AF for less than $300. Worth sending the camera in my opinion since they pretty much made it operate in like new condition.

My buddies had similar issue and was able to have the hot shoe mount issue corrected after the authorized center replaced the hot shoe.
